You also have to know whether your motherboard supports DDR3, DDR3L, or DDR4 RAM modules. The difference between DDR3 (L) and DDR4 is in a notch at the bottom of the RAM module. In DDR3 (L) modules, this notch is left of center. In DDR4 modules, this notch is right of center.

Web22 feb. 2015 · SuperUser contributor Yass has the answer for us: The “ + ” usually indicates that the motherboard supports RAM with a frequency of over 3000 MHz. The OC in brackets means that the motherboard allows the RAM to be over-clocked. The caveats being that you may need to increase the voltage and/or the timings in order to …
